Working Principles

MMPF0100F1EP operates based on a combination of switching regulators, linear regulators, and control circuitry. It efficiently converts the input voltage to multiple regulated output voltages required by different components within an electronic device. The integrated control circuitry ensures proper power sequencing, overcurrent protection, and thermal shutdown.
